What is a Meal Delivery Service?
A meal delivery service brings the convenience of pre-planned, pre-portioned, and sometimes pre-cooked meals directly to your home. The best meal service for families ensures that you can enjoy nutritious and delicious meals without the hassle of grocery shopping or meal prep.
While food delivery services offering pre-cooked food have been around for hundreds of years, meal kit services are a relatively new development that started in 2003 in Scandinavia and spread to the United States in 2012. These companies enjoyed a surge in popularity during the pandemic and have continued to be a popular choice for people who want to save time, try new recipes, and reduce food waste.
What Types of Meal Delivery Services Are There?
Meal kits
Best meal kits provide all the ingredients you need to cook a meal at home, along with easy-to-follow instructions. They’re perfect for those who enjoy cooking but prefer to skip meal planning and grocery shopping.
Fully prepared meals
Fully prepared meals are ready to eat with minimal heating required. These are ideal for busy individuals who want to enjoy a home-cooked meal without spending time in the kitchen.
Specialized dietary plans
Many meal services cater to specific nutritional needs, such as keto, vegan, paleo, high-protein, or anti-inflammatory. Most provide detailed ingredient lists and nutritional information online so you can easily check if a meal suits your dietary requirements.
Allergy-friendly meal options
Meal services know how important allergen-free products are to many consumers, such as people with celiac disease or nut allergies. Some companies also specially wrap their products to prevent cross-contamination.
Organic food and sustainable sourcing
Many meal subscription services proudly showcase their certified organic and sustainable options on their websites. These credentials may include USDA Organic certification, MSC-certified sustainable seafood, or B Corp certification.
Weight loss plans
If you’re looking for a strict diet meal plan, many health-focused meal services will send you dietitian-planned meals to enable you to eat healthier and lose weight. Healthy meal kits will help you to control your eating by planning meals ahead of time and learning new cooking techniques you can integrate into your daily life.
Family meal plan
Many meal delivery services feature family meals and “kid-friendly” recipes. Kid-friendly recipes are dishes your kids may recognize and are typically not spicy. These plans typically include meals designed for four people and often cost less per serving.
How Do family Meal Delivery Services Work?
Family meal delivery services simplify meal planning and preparation by delivering ready-to-cook or pre-prepared meals directly to your door. These services are designed to make it easier for families to enjoy nutritious meals together, without the hassle of planning and shopping. The process typically starts with signing up on a company’s website or mobile app. During registration, you may be prompted to answer questions about your family’s dietary preferences and restrictions, which helps the service personalize family meal plans that cater to your specific needs.
Once signed up, you can choose your meals from a weekly rotating menu. Many services offer best family meal plans that include a variety of meal options suitable for every member of the family. You can select portion sizes and the number of meals per week based on your individual or family meal plan needs. Healthy meal delivery for families generally emphasizes flexibility, allowing you to skip weeks or change meal choices as long as you do so by a specified deadline before the next delivery. This flexibility ensures that your family meal plan can adapt to your family's busy schedule, making it easier to maintain a healthy eating routine.

Meal Delivery Glossary:
Pre-portioned ingredients (Meal kits)
Components of a meal that have been measured and cut to the exact amounts required for a recipe.
Fully prepared meals
Complete dishes that are cooked and assembled prior to delivery, requiring minimal to no preparation. They are delivered chilled or frozen to maintain quality and freshness.
Subscription service
A business model where customers pay a recurring fee to receive their meal service according to a pre-agreed schedule.
Dietary preferences
Requirements or choices that influence an individual's eating habits, such as vegetarian, vegan, gluten-free, keto, paleo, and other specialized diets.
Freshness guarantee
A commitment by meal delivery services to deliver ingredients at their peak freshness to maximize their flavor and nutritional value.

Factor is a chef-crafted, dietician-approved meal service that provides an approachable way to try healthy diets with heat-and-serve meals. Mary Sabat, a nutritionist and president of Body Designs, remarks on how they're "worth the extra money" and offer "many options for someone trying to stick to a specific diet."
Factor makes information transparent about their ingredients and nutrition, so you can filter out recipes that may not suit your wellness goals. Their meals range between 300-900 calories, giving you an easy way to lose weight depending on the low-calorie meals you choose to eat.
Why we chose Factor: In addition to Factor's microwave- or oven-ready dishes, they also offer nourishing add-ons like juices, smoothies, shakes, cookies, desserts, and breakfasts.
Our experience: Though the recipes were often high in fat, the ingredients were clean and of premium quality. We liked that we were able to hone in on the right meal plan for us through a complimentary consultation with one of their registered dietitians.

HelloFresh makes it convenient to enjoy wholesome, fresh meals with minimal prep. Ron Stewart, a former corporate executive chef at Pastini, tested HelloFresh and was "surprised at the quality of ingredients and ease of putting together exceptional meals," calling their recipes "delicious as well as nutritious and balanced."
Each week, HelloFresh lets you choose from over 100 breakfast, lunch, and dinner recipes. Every kit includes straightforward, step-by-step recipe cards with fresh, pre-measured ingredients to help you get dinner on the table in under an hour.
This service is best for individuals and households without strict dietary requirements, though they offer low-carb and lower-calorie meals too. It's possible to separately review ingredient information for each meal before ordering, including nutritional value and allergens, and any additional items you may need.
Why we chose HelloFresh: You can easily adjust or cancel your food delivery and subscription at any time. Meals are not overly complicated and reduce the need to buy ingredients in addition to what's delivered for each recipe.
Our experience: We liked that HelloFresh lets you know ahead of time what cookware you'll need so you can get cooking as soon as your delivery arrives. It was extra convenient that their extensive menu also let us swap out proteins.

Home Chef is a meal service designed for cooks of any skill level. Each delivery provides recipe cards with step-by-step instructions and photos. Research by Hartmann et al. shows that enhanced cooking skills encourage healthier eating habits and thus improve nutrition. This makes Home Chef an excellent tool to achieve better health, by teaching you new recipes and techniques.
Choose from over 20 recipes each week and swap out proteins to your liking. Home Chef lets you filter and eliminate recipes with specific allergens, such as tree nuts, peanuts, sesame seeds, mushrooms, fish, and shellfish. However, they can't guarantee their meals are entirely free of cross-contamination.
Why we chose Home Chef: Their pre-portioned, partially prepared ingredients simplify and expedite food prep and clean up, while eliminating food waste.
Our experience: We found Home Chef's recipe cards easy to follow and meals sizable enough to feed a hungry adult comfortably. We liked that we could save our recipe cards in a binder (included in your first order) for reference at any time.
